Irish Whiskies Amp Up The Volume For St. Patrick’s Day

Irish whiskey is among the most ascendant categories in the U.S. spirits market, trailing only Tequila for imported spirits growth in 2022, according to Impact Databank. The category cracked six million cases last year, continuing a long-term upswing in which it’s expanded every year for the last quarter century, with the lone exception of pandemic-disrupted 2020.
